I really hate the fact that I open an email, open the attachment (word or
Publisher) , then spend 4 hours editing a document someone sent me.

I press save, and close the document.


It gets saved in "Temporary Internet Files\may be OLKxx folder"

I open Word or Publisher again to work on the file, and It is not in the
recent documents list.


It is in my MS Word recently opened list.

Then I remember that it was an attachment in an email - Open that
attachment
again, but what I get is the un-edited version.


True but when you close your email where the file is attached to, you're
asked "Do you want to save changes?" If you click Yes, you will have the
updated version (re)attached to that mail. If you click No, the email AND
attachment(s) are unchanged (which is normal).

The version that I worked on for 4 hours is GONE!


It's not. It's in the "Temporary Internet Files\may be OLKxx folder".
Take a look. It may still be there.
